M57 and IC1296, crop from 100% image size.

M57 and IC1296, crop from 100% image size.(CAMBRE Philippe)

Acquisition Date : May 28, 2005
Camera : Canon EOS 350D with DSLRFOCUS 3.1
Camera Settings : 9 x 5 minutes @ 400 ISO, RAW mode
Telescope : Vixen R200SS (200/800) with retouched primary mirror + Paracorr
Mount : Modified syntha EQ6 with MCU kit for autoguiding
Adapter / Prime / Afocal / Other : Prime focus, guided with a kepler MC90 (90/500) and Astro art 3.
Processing Package / Processing Applied : Raw decompression, darks, flats, offsets, aligning, stacking made with Iris for the processing, and Photoshop CS for the completion.
Web Site : http://astrosurf.com/halfie/
NOTES : Image made in my garden ( obernai: city of 12 00 inhabitants), medium seeing, focusing was hard to get, FWHM mini was 3, versus 2 on better conditions ;O).
You can see the small galaxy IC1296 on the right, magnitude 15.4 *:O)!
